"Changes since MRBS 1.6.1 :

  - Fixed a number of security issues in MRBS that were
    disclosed to the project by SySS GmbH, including XSS,
    CSRF protection and session fixation.

  - Improved behaviour of browser caching in MRBS.

  - Improved localisation, especially the use of colons in
    labels.

  - Added new config variable $weekdays to define weekdays
    and weekends, allowing for the possibility that weekdays
    are not the same as working days.

  - MRBS now restricts form actions which modify data/pass
    passwords to only accept POSTs.

  - Added the ability to have different period names in each
    area.

  - Add SAML auth and session schemes, thanks to Jørn
    Åne.

  - Updated to jQuery 3.2.1 and jQueryUI 1.12.1, which
    includes XSS fixes.

  - Plus a few other bug fixes/improvements.

  - Dropped support for Internet Explorer 9 and lower.
